Sun 26 July… when we stayed in Tamworth and spent some time with Hamish he recommended we visit a town called Sawtell, just a few K’s down the road from Coffs Harbour. He used to holiday there when he was a child. So, off we went this morning, after bacon and eggs a la grandad, to have a look. It’s a miserable sort of a day, typically Brit, grey and chilly which unfortunately didn’t do Sawtell any favours. Sawtell is noted for it’s beautiful sandy bay so when did we arrive? High tide on a crap day. Couldn’t go on the beach as there wasn’t any. We could see it’s obviously a beautiful bay when the sun is shining, just our luck. We walked up and down the main drag and then back to Coffs for lunch. There was a bit of a market there selling tat which killed 10 minutes.
Coffs is famous for it’s Big Banana which is now a tourist attraction and has several rides, plus a sky walk over the banana plantation which was closed, as was the water slide, the bungee trampoline and the trike hire. In fact it was all shut except for the tacky gift shop and the toboggan run, which was great fun. It’s a stainless steel chute with the toboggans on wheels everybody had a go except the Navigator who declined thinking she would probably get lost! That was the highlight of the day. Still you can’t win them all.
